WebRead word problems slowly and carefully several times so that all students comprehend. If possible, break up the problem into smaller segments. Allow students to act out the word problems to better comprehend what they are being asked to solve. Provide manipulatives to help students visualize the problem. WebTo solve a system of linear equations word problem: Select variables to represent the unknown quantities. Using the given information, write a system of two linear equations relating the two variables. Solve the system of linear equations using either … WebYou can tackle any word problem by following these five steps: Read through the problem carefully, and figure out what it's about. Represent unknown numbers with variables. Translate the rest of the problem into a mathematical expression. Solve the problem. Check your work. Web1.6 Unit Conversion Word Problems. One application of rational expressions deals with converting units. Units of measure can be converted by multiplying several fractions together in a process known as dimensional analysis. The trick is to decide what fractions to multiply. If an expression is multiplied by 1, its value does not change.
